About the Role

This position serves as a vital partner in the educational journey of students with diverse needs. You will guide learning in accordance with the district's philosophy, ensuring the achievement of both curriculum goals and individualized education program (IEP) objectives. The role requires a unique blend of instructional expertise and therapeutic support, where you will implement instructional, therapeutic, or skill development programs tailored to assigned students.

In this capacity, you will collaborate closely with students, parents, and staff to develop IEPs through the Admission, Review, and Dismissal (ARD) Committee process. Your day-to-day involves planning and utilizing appropriate instructional strategies that reflect an understanding of various learning styles, while also offering accelerated instruction to students meeting state "at-risk" criteria. You will be responsible for creating a classroom environment conducive to learning and appropriate for the physical, social, and emotional development of students, managing behavior through positive, proactive, and instructional means.

Beyond the classroom, you will work cooperatively with instructional supervisors and colleagues to modify curricula for special education, 504, ELL, and GT students. You will also supervise teacher aides and volunteers, integrate technology into teaching, and maintain open communication with all stakeholders. As a positive role model, you will take necessary precautions to protect students and ensure their safety during drills and crisis situations.

Hiring Process

Candidates must possess a B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university and a valid Texas certificate for the subject and level assigned. Applicants should have at least one year of student teaching or an approved internship. The selection process focuses on identifying individuals with demonstrated competency in their subject area, knowledge of special needs, and the ability to incorporate behavior principles effectively.

Clear Creek Independent School District operates as a major education administration program based in League City, Texas. Serving over 42,000 students, the district stands as the 27th largest in the state and covers 103 square miles across Harris and Galveston counties. The district encompasses 13 municipalities and is situated near the NASA Johnson Space Center and the Gulf of Mexico, positioning it as a significant educational hub in the Greater Houston area. The organization is governed by a seven-member elected Board of Trustees representing diverse community areas. This structure supports a governance model that actively involves stakeholders in shaping curriculum, finance, and policy decisions. The primary focus of the district remains on prioritizing the best interests of children while fostering an environment conducive to educational growth and family life.
